It seems that if you have a graphic in one of the cells already the (color, graphic) drop down box does not appear. You should be able to select a row and replace the cell background with whatever you select. Since the functionality is there to set the background of each cell in a column/row when there is no graphic set for any cell in the row/column I am changing this to a defect.
